PD035QU2 the information contained herein is the exclusive property of pr ime view international co., ltd. and shall not be distributed, reproduced, or disclosed in whole or in part without prior written permission of prime view international co., ltd. page:22 15 . h andling cautions 15-1) m ounting of module a) please power off the module when you connect the input/output connector. b) polarizer which is made of soft material and susceptible to flaw must be handled carefully. c)protective film (laminator) is applied on surface to protect it against scratches and dirt. 15-2) precautions in mounting a) when metal part of the t f t-lcd module (shielding lid and rear case) is soiled, wipe it with soft dry cloth. b) wipe off water drops or finger grease immediately. long contact with water may cause discoloration or spots. c) t f t-lcd module uses glass which breaks or cracks easily if dropped or bumped on hard surface. please handle with care. d) s ince c mos l s i is used in the module. s o take care of static electricity and earth yourself when handling. 15-3) adjusting module a) adjusting volumes on the rear face of the module have been set optimally before shipment. b) therefore, do not change any adjusted values. if adjusted values are changed, the specifications described may not be satisfied. 15-4) o thers a) do not expose the module to direct sunlight or intensive ultraviolet rays for many hours. b) s tore the module at a room temperature place. c) the voltage of beginning electric discharge may over the normal voltage because of leakage current from approach conductor by to draw lump read lead line around. d) if lcd panel breaks, it is possibly that the liquid crystal escapes from the panel. avoid putting it into eyes or mouth. when liquid crystal sticks on hands, clothes or feet. wash it out immediately with soap. e) o bserve all other precautionary requirements in handling general electronic components. f ) please adjust the voltage of common electrode as material of attachment by 1 module. 15-5) polarizer mark the polarizer mark is to describe the direction of view angle film how to mach up with the rubbing direction.
PD035QU2 the information contained herein is the exclusive property of pr ime view international co., ltd. and shall not be distributed, reproduced, or disclosed in whole or in part without prior written permission of prime view international co., ltd. page:23 16. r eliability test n o test item test condition 1 h igh temperature s torage test ta = +80 : , 240 hrs 2 low temperature s torage test ta = -30 : , 240 hrs 3 h igh temperature o peration test ta = +70 : , 240 hrs 4 low temperature o peration test ta = -20 : , 240 hrs 5 h igh temperature & h igh h umidity o peration test ta = +60 : , 90% rh , 240 hrs 6 thermal s hock test (non-operating) -20 :( +70 : , 100 cycles, 30 min 30 min 7 vibration test (non-operating) frequency:10~550h z a mplitude: 1 . 3mm sweep:1 . 5 g ,33 . 3~400hz vibration: sinusoidal wave ,1hrs for x,y,z direction 8 s hock test (non-operating) 100g, 6ms direction : d x, d y, d z cycle : 3 times h alf sinusoidal wave 9 electrostatic discharge test (non-operating) 150p f , 330  air : 8kv ; contact : 6kv ta: ambient temperature n ote : the protective film must be removed before temperature test . [criteria] 1 . the test samples have recove ry time for 2 hours at room temp erature before the function check . i n the standard conditions, there is no display function ng issue occurred . 2 . a ll the cosmetic specifications are judged before the reliability stress .
